Always demonstrate slowly first, then at full speed. Exaggerate key technique points. Use students as positive examples when appropriate. Connect movements to familiar activities or sports.
Minimum 20m x 15m, clear flat surface, adequate runoff space beyond ladders
Dry, non-slip surface free from holes or obstacles, indoor or outdoor suitable
Stop activity immediately if injury occurs, assess situation, provide appropriate first aid, ensure other students remain safely positioned
